There are two different things being discussed here, I think. One is the cargo divider that extends up to the ceiling and the othervis a net that attaches parallel to the cargo floor to secure groceries and the like.
The first requires lash points in the ceiling, is integrated with the cargo cover, and comes with the storage package. I don't know if all X3s come with the ceiling lash points. If they do, may be able to buy it later, but I bet it'll be expensive. The second also comes with the storage package but us intended to work with he rail system. You can buy it later, but you'll need rails to use it. There might be another net option, though. The second

Yes, There are holes in the celing right above the 2nd row of seat and another set right behind the front seats. This allows you to partition either everything behind the front seats or just the space behind the 2nd row.
Just build an X3 with the convienece package (in the US) and do a 360* view. You will see the mounting points. |
